// Copyright 2022 The Fuchsia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#ifndef FUCHSIA_SDK_EXAMPLES_CC_I2C_TEMPERATURE_H_
#define FUCHSIA_SDK_EXAMPLES_CC_I2C_TEMPERATURE_H_
#include <fidl/fuchsia.driver.framework/cpp/wire.h>
#include <fidl/fuchsia.hardware.i2c/cpp/wire.h>
#include <fidl/sample.i2ctemperature/cpp/wire.h>
#include <lib/driver2/namespace.h>
#include <lib/driver2/structured_logger.h>
#include <lib/fdf/cpp/dispatcher.h>
#include <lib/sys/component/llcpp/outgoing_directory.h>
#include <lib/zx/status.h>
#include "i2c_channel.h"
namespace i2c_temperature {
// Sample driver that demonstrates how to communicate through an I2C protocol.
class I2cTemperatureDriver : public fidl::WireServer<sample_i2ctemperature::Device> {
public:
I2cTemperatureDriver(async_dispatcher_t* dispatcher,
fidl::WireSharedClient<fuchsia_driver_framework::Node> node,
driver::Namespace ns, driver::Logger logger)
: dispatcher_(dispatcher),
node_(std::move(node)),
outgoing_(component::OutgoingDirectory::Create(dispatcher)),
ns_(std::move(ns)),
logger_(std::move(logger)) {}
virtual ~I2cTemperatureDriver() = default;
static constexpr const char* Name() { return "i2c-temperature"; }
static zx::status<std::unique_ptr<I2cTemperatureDriver>> Start(
fuchsia_driver_framework::wire::DriverStartArgs& start_args,
fdf::UnownedDispatcher dispatcher,
fidl::WireSharedClient<fuchsia_driver_framework::Node> node, driver::Namespace ns,
driver::Logger logger);
// fuchsia.hardware.i2ctemperature/Device:
void ReadTemperature(ReadTemperatureRequestView request,
ReadTemperatureCompleter::Sync& completer);
void ResetSensor(ResetSensorRequestView request, ResetSensorCompleter::Sync& completer);
private:
zx::status<> Run(fidl::ServerEnd<fuchsia_io::Directory> outgoing_dir);
zx::status<> SetupI2cChannel();
async_dispatcher_t* const dispatcher_;
fidl::WireSharedClient<fuchsia_driver_framework::Node> node_;
component::OutgoingDirectory outgoing_;
driver::Namespace ns_;
driver::Logger logger_;
std::unique_ptr<I2cChannel> i2c_channel_;
};
} // namespace i2c_temperature
#endif // FUCHSIA_SDK_EXAMPLES_CC_I2C_TEMPERATURE_H_
